Detailed vulnerability description

The vulnerability allows a local user to perform a denial of service (DoS) attack.

The vulnerability exists due to improper control of a resource through its lifetime in in FortiEDR Collector. A local privileged user can change permissions on the application's root directory and make it unresponsive.


How to mitigate CVE-2022-23446

The vulnerability is fixed in FortiEDR Collector version 5.0.3 b0508 and above.
